Notes
Mayall's seminal 1966 debut, his arrival as a recording artist and his commercial breakthrough-the epic Bluesbreakers story begins here! Maybe the most influential British blues album ever, it features ex-Yardbird Clapton's simply scorching playing on All Your Love; Hideaway; What'd I Say; Parchman Farm; Ramblin' on My Mind; Steppin' Out, and more.
